## Recovering the EchoWalk Admin Account

If the admin account for EchoWalk (the Marlowe Museum audio-guide app) gets locked — usually after too many failed logins from the gallery tablets — don't panic. Put the app in maintenance mode, then open the local recovery screen on the docent desk terminal. It'll prompt you, and you'll need the passphrase below.

vault phrase of fahog-yajof = istael-zorwyn

## Runbook: Marrowgate stale-cache incident

Root cause: the Marrowgate edge cache ignored invalidation events during the broker failover, serving expired session payloads for 14 minutes. Mitigation: invalidation now fans out over two channels with a reconciliation sweep. Review scope: confirm no auth decisions read from cache. The cache layer runs with these values.

settings of tagef-bawif:
DRUIX_HOST=druix.zemvarlabs.internal
DRUIX_PORT=8000

**Alert: soft-delete anomaly, orders table (Cartwheel DB).** Fires when rows in `orders` have `deleted_at` set without a matching audit-log entry, or when soft-deleted rows are read by non-admin queries. Possible causes: direct SQL bypassing the Ledgerline API, or a misconfigured reporting job. Treat unexplained triggers as potential data-exfiltration cover. Triage steps and query allowlist are documented on the internal page.

wiki page, tahaf-tajog: https://jira.ordindyn.corp/pipeline

Runbook: Shelfwright catalogue import, account recovery. If the importer account locks mid-run at the Dunmere branch, halt the job, verify no partial records committed, then invoke the recovery flow from the admin console. The flow prompts for the stored passphrase before restoring access. Use the recovery passphrase shown below.

unlock words, kajef-kadug: sorys-pelax-lamael-tamvan-briiel-novdor-fenwyn-tamdor-oliion-keleth-julok-belion-ralok

To the dispatch desk: the full set of master keys for the Arden Court premises must travel to the Welbeck Annexe today. The keys are in a sealed tamper-evident pouch, logged by the office manager this morning. Only the vetted courier from Quillon Secure may carry them, and the pouch must not leave their person. At hand-over, the courier is to be told the following.

handover note for yagef-bagep: the drudor pelius courier leaves the kasdor zorvan norir ledger at gate 8016 under passcode 755406